Welcome to MtM #Vegas​ – Our weekly look at the cool #news​ and happenings in Sin City.

This week we debrief Mark’s recent Vegas trip which included a stay at one of the more unique rooms in Vegas. He also details his check-in experience, what it is like at Circa’s rooftop Legacy Club and his “bottle service” experience at Drai’s. Plus how is the food and service at Giada’s in Cromwell?

We also dive into the #Caesars Entertainment earnings call and Virgin’s announcement about resort fees. What did Caesars say about their losses and how are bookings looking into the future? They lost $1.8 billion which means unprofitable venues aren’t likely to return soon. Sorry buffet lovers.

Having read "trip reports" for over twenty years, one thing is clear: your first two encounters at a hotel -valet and front desk – will set the tone for your stay. Even if the check-in line is long, if you are treated as if you are welcome and if a reasonable effort is made to accommodate your requests in a pleasant manner, and if your room is what you asked for and clean, that goodwill will last. If, on the other hand, the check-in person is surly and unresponsive, the guests will spend their entire stay looking for flaws and complaints.
Large hotels spend millions on research and focus groups, but fail to appreciate this basic principle.
